Transaction 99d5511a8466230ed764983c6f85f502ed14719900a23e3b0de0aacc618a5537

1 Input
1 Outputs
  • 99d5511a8466230ed764983c6f85f502ed14719900a23e3b0de0aacc618a5537:0
  • value  3125413
    address  1KADuRLMHTp6FgGxLP6HHDZJCp7BfSuQp2